A sportsbook is a gambling establishment that accepts bets on various sporting events. It also offers odds and betting lines for those bets. Its employees are trained to understand the rules and regulations of each sport so they can properly place wagers for customers. A sportsbook must also be licensed and meet all state and federal regulations. It must have a security system in place to prevent money laundering and other illegal activities. When it comes to sportsbooks, the number of bets placed varies throughout the year. Betting volume at these sportsbooks peaks when certain sports are in season. These peaks are driven by the passion of sports fans and their excitement to bet on their favorite teams.
